Advertisement
Loading...

테이블 포매터

스프레드시트에서 붙여넣기(탭으로 구분됨), CSV 또는 수동으로 데이터 입력

이보다 긴 셀 내용을 잘라냅니다.

시작하려면 데이터를 붙여넣으세요.

왼쪽 패널에 탭으로 구분된, CSV 또는 파이프 구분 테이블 데이터를 입력한 후, 테두리 스타일을 선택하여 형식이 지정된 ASCII 테이블 출력을 여기에서 확인하세요.

Advertisement
Loading...

ASCII 테이블 도구 사용 방법

1

테이블 데이터를 붙여넣거나 입력하세요.

테이블 포맷터 탭으로 전환하고 텍스트 영역에 데이터를 붙여넣으세요. 스프레드시트(Excel, Google Sheets)에서 직접 복사할 수 있으며, 열은 자동으로 탭으로 구분됩니다. 또는 쉼표, 파이프 구분 값 또는 기타 구분 기호를 사용하여 CSV 데이터를 입력하세요. '샘플 데이터 로드'를 클릭하여 즉시 작동 예제를 확인하세요.

2

구분 기호 및 헤더 모드 선택

입력 데이터와 일치하는 열 구분 기호를 선택하세요 — 스프레드시트 붙여넣기에는 탭, CSV 파일에는 쉼표, 파이프 구분 데이터에는 파이프를 선택하세요. 그런 다음 헤더 행 옵션을 설정하세요: 첫 번째 행이 헤더인 경우 '첫 번째 행은 헤더'를 선택하여 첫 번째 행 아래에 굵은 구분선이 적용되어 출력에서 열 제목과 데이터 행을 시각적으로 구분합니다.

3

테두리 스타일 선택

선호하는 테이블 스타일을 선택하기 위해 시각적 썸네일 미리보기 그리드를 탐색하세요. 옵션에는 클래식 ASCII 아트를 위한 MySQL/Plus, 현대적인 박스 그리기 문자를 위한 유니코드 단일 또는 이중, 우아한 모서리를 위한 둥근 스타일, README 파일 및 위키를 위한 Markdown/GitHub, 최소 레이아웃을 위한 컴팩트, 웹 페이지를 위한 HTML, 그리고 테두리 선이 전혀 필요 없는 문서를 위한 일반이 포함됩니다.

4

ASCII 참조 복사, 다운로드 또는 탐색

복사 버튼을 클릭하여 형식이 지정된 테이블을 클립보드로 전송하거나, 다운로드 .txt를 클릭하여 파일로 저장하세요. ASCII 참조 탭으로 전환하여 모든 문자의 십진수, 16진수, 8진수, 이진수 및 HTML 값을 조회하세요. 검색 상자를 사용하여 이름, 코드 또는 문자로 필터링하세요. 어떤 행이든 클릭하여 모든 값을 복사하세요. 전체 참조 차트를 CSV 파일로 내보낼 수 있습니다.

자주 묻는 질문

프로그래밍에서 ASCII 테이블이란 무엇인가요?

프로그래밍에서 'ASCII 테이블'은 두 가지를 의미합니다. 첫째, 정수 0–127을 문자에 매핑하는 문자 참조 테이블 — 이것이 ASCII 참조 탭에서 보여주는 것입니다. 둘째, 'ASCII 아트 테이블'은 박스 그리기 문자나 플러스 기호, 대시, 파이프와 같은 구두점으로 렌더링된 텍스트 기반 그리드입니다. ASCII 아트 테이블은 특별한 형식이 필요 없고 모든 고정폭 글꼴 환경에서 올바르게 표시되기 때문에 명령줄 도구, README 파일, 소스 코드 주석 및 터미널 출력에서 널리 사용됩니다. Markdown 파이프 테이블( GitHub, GitLab 및 많은 위키에서 사용됨)은 오늘날 가장 일반적인 ASCII 아트 테이블 형태 중 하나입니다.

스프레드시트를 ASCII 테이블로 변환하려면 어떻게 하나요?

Excel 또는 Google Sheets에서 스프레드시트를 열고 원하는 셀을 선택한 다음 복사하세요(Ctrl+C 또는 Cmd+C). 복사한 데이터를 이 도구의 테이블 데이터 텍스트 영역에 붙여넣으세요 — 스프레드시트 셀은 복사할 때 자동으로 탭으로 구분되므로 구분 기호로 '탭'을 선택하세요. 첫 번째 행에 열 제목이 포함되어 있는 경우 '첫 번째 행은 헤더'를 선택하세요. 그런 다음 썸네일 미리보기 그리드에서 선호하는 테두리 스타일을 선택하세요. 형식이 지정된 ASCII 테이블이 즉시 생성되며 클립보드에 복사하거나 .txt 파일로 다운로드할 수 있습니다.

유니코드 단일, 유니코드 이중 및 MySQL 테이블 스타일의 차이는 무엇인가요?

MySQL 스타일(플러스 스타일이라고도 함)은 기본 ASCII 구두점만 사용합니다: 모서리와 교차점에 플러스 기호, 수평선에 대시, 수직선에 파이프 문자를 사용합니다. 모든 터미널 및 텍스트 편집기와 보편적으로 호환됩니다. 유니코드 단일은 더 깔끔하고 세련된 외관을 위해 유니코드 표준의 실제 박스 그리기 문자를 사용합니다(┌─│┐└┘├┤┬┴┼). 유니코드 이중은 더욱 대담한 외관을 위해 이중선 변형(╔═║╗╚╝╠╣╦╩╬)을 사용합니다. 유니코드 스타일은 박스 그리기 문자를 지원하는 글꼴이 필요하며, 모든 현대 터미널 및 편집기가 이를 지원합니다.

공백, 줄 바꿈 및 탭과 같은 일반 문자의 ASCII 코드는 무엇인가요?

공백은 ASCII 코드 32(16진수 20)입니다. 탭(수평 탭, HT)은 코드 9(16진수 09)입니다. 줄 바꿈 또는 줄 피드(LF)는 코드 10(16진수 0A)입니다. 캐리지 리턴(CR)은 코드 13(16진수 0D)입니다. 백스페이스(BS)는 코드 8(16진수 08)입니다. 이스케이프(ESC)는 코드 27(16진수 1B)입니다. 삭제(DEL)는 코드 127(16진수 7F)입니다. 숫자 0–9는 코드 48–57입니다. 대문자 A–Z는 코드 65–90입니다. 소문자 a–z는 코드 97–122입니다. ASCII 참조 탭을 사용하여 어떤 문자든 즉시 조회할 수 있습니다 — 문자, 십진수 또는 16진수 값을 검색 상자에 입력하세요.

이 도구를 사용하여 GitHub README용 Markdown 테이블을 생성할 수 있나요?

네 — 'Markdown / GitHub' 테두리 스타일을 선택하여 GitHub에서 형식이 지정된 HTML 테이블로 렌더링되는 GitHub-Flavored Markdown(GFM) 파이프 테이블을 생성할 수 있습니다. 출력은 표준 | 열 | 형식을 사용하며 헤더와 데이터 행 사이에 대시로 구분된 행이 있습니다. 텍스트 정렬(왼쪽, 중앙, 오른쪽)은 구분 행에서 콜론 표기법(:---:, ---:, :---)을 사용하여 인코딩됩니다. 출력을 README.md 또는 위키 페이지에 붙여넣으면 적절한 형식의 테이블로 렌더링됩니다.

제어 문자는 무엇이며, 왜 기호로 표시되나요?

제어 문자는 첫 32개의 ASCII 문자(코드 0–31)와 DEL(127)입니다. 이들은 원래 전신 기계와 직렬 통신을 제어하기 위해 설계되었습니다 — '헤딩 시작', '텍스트 끝', '벨', '백스페이스', '이스케이프'와 같은 명령들입니다. 이들은 출력되지 않기 때문에, 표에 표시하기 위해서는 시각적 대체물이 필요합니다. 이 도구는 표준 유니코드 제어 그림 블록(U+2400–U+241F)을 사용하여 각 제어 문자에 전용 글리프를 할당합니다: ␀는 NUL, ␇는 BEL, ␈는 BS, ␉는 HT(탭), ␊는 LF(새 줄), ␍는 CR, ␛는 ESC 등입니다. 이러한 기호는 참조 표에서 제어 문자를 한눈에 보고 식별할 수 있게 해줍니다.